Why Are Fully Automatic Probe Stations Transforming Semiconductor Testing and Characterization?
Fully automatic probe stations are revolutionizing semiconductor testing and wafer-level analysis by offering unprecedented precision, efficiency, and automation in the measurement and evaluation of integrated circuits (ICs), MEMS, and nanodevices. These systems are critical in both R&D and production environments, where the demand for fast, reliable, and highly repeatable electrical testing has grown in parallel with the increasing complexity and miniaturization of semiconductor components. Unlike manual or semi-automatic stations, fully automatic systems are capable of executing complex testing protocols with minimal human intervention, dramatically reducing operator error, test cycle times, and the risk of sample contamination. They are equipped with high-resolution positioning systems, robotic wafer handling arms, environmental control chambers, and integrated data acquisition systems that enable precise probing at the micron and sub-micron scale. This level of automation is essential in validating next-generation chips for applications in 5G, automotive electronics, quantum computing, and AI-driven devices. Furthermore, as wafer sizes increase and device nodes shrink, the need for probe stations that can handle high-density test structures and deliver accurate results under varying temperature and vacuum conditions becomes paramount. The versatility and high-performance capabilities of fully automatic probe stations are driving their adoption across a broadening range of industries beyond traditional semiconductor fabs. In academic and corporate R&D laboratories, these stations are indispensable for the characterization of emerging materials, such as graphene, GaN, SiC, and other wide-bandgap semiconductors, which are central to the development of next-generation high-frequency and high-power devices. The aerospace and defense sectors utilize fully automatic probe stations to test radiation-hardened and ruggedized electronics that must perform reliably under extreme environmental conditions. In the automotive industry, as electronic content in vehicles expands with the advent of ADAS, EVs, and connected car technologies, the need for precise wafer-level testing of power ICs, sensors, and microcontrollers is escalating. Biomedical device manufacturers rely on probe stations to evaluate microfluidic and biosensing components at the wafer level to ensure consistent device performance and patient safety. Additionally, in the fast-growing domain of photonics and optoelectronics, these systems are used to test laser diodes, photodetectors, and silicon photonic circuits with ultra-fine alignment and optical probing capabilities. The growing demand for ultra-reliable electronic components across all these domains has created a robust market for advanced probe stations that can deliver high throughput and analytical depth. Cutting-edge innovations in robotics, AI, optics, and thermal management are redefining the precision, speed, and usability of fully automatic probe stations. One of the most significant technological advancements is the integration of ultra-high-resolution optical alignment systems that leverage machine vision and pattern recognition algorithms to automate wafer alignment and probing with nanometer-scale accuracy. Robotic wafer handlers now feature vibration-minimizing motion platforms and advanced safety mechanisms that allow for 24/7 operation with minimal downtime. New temperature-controlled chuck technologies enable testing under extreme thermal conditions from cryogenic temperatures for quantum devices to high heat for automotive and power applications while ensuring consistent contact and signal integrity. Multi-sensor feedback loops, real-time diagnostics, and auto-correction algorithms have drastically improved yield and reduced rework rates. In parallel, the adoption of open software platforms and remote interface capabilities allows for seamless integration into larger test automation environments, making probe stations an integral part of smart manufacturing ecosystems. Probe card technology has also evolved, with MEMS-based and vertical probe solutions that support finer pitch and higher parallelism, facilitating the testing of complex multi-die and 3D-stacked devices. Additionally, modular station designs allow for customization based on specific application needs, from high-frequency RF testing to mixed-signal and parametric measurements.
